About this listen

The innocent and insolent Daisy confronts the traditions of old Europe and confounds all of the people (especially the men) who surround her. All throughout the story, there are classic Jamesian views on the differences between English and American societies.Public Domain (P)1984 Audio Book Contractors, Inc.
